PAINT/ROTO ARTIST

Description

JOB SUMMARY

Reporting to the Paint/Roto Supervisor, the Paint/Roto artist supports and partners with compositors to integrate seamlessly all elements of a shot to the highest level of VFX "realism" for major feature films.

RESPONSIBILITIES

Roto tasks include;

  • 2D Camera Tracking,
  • Character roto-scoping (2+ years experience)
  • Motion Blur (2+ years experience)

Paint tasks include:

  • Frame by Frame 
  • Camera Projections
  • Plate restoration
  • Colour correction
  • Tracking Marker Removal
  • Rig and Wire Removal
  • Green Screen Clean up
  • Dust Busting
  • Complete assigned tasks effectively; able to troubleshoot and QA own work to the highest quality
  • Attend production meetings; complete corrections/revisions based on feedback and partner with compositors to complete shots
  • Able to provide estimates for workflow and schedules; deliver high quality of work under tight deadlines
  • Train, mentor and support Junior staff
QUALIFICATIONS & SKILLS
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ience
  • Degree/Diploma in Digital Media Arts (preferred)
  • 4+ years experience working in major (realism) feature films
  • Intermediate to Advanced knowledge/experience with Nuke, Silhouette, Mocha (required), and Maya (preferred)
  • Ability to receive and implement feedback quickly and effectively; takes direction well
  • Strong written and oral communication skills, team player, and time management skills
  • Able to work independently with minimal supervision; strong trouble shooting/problem solving ability; escalates issues as needed
  • Knowledge of Photography + traditional are background an asset
